AUTUMN WREATH-MAKING
There is something special about this time of year. The air changes, the colours deepen, and nature begins offering us the most beautiful materials to create with.
This Mother & Daughter workshop is an invitation to connect with the season through creativity, tradition, and the joy of working with our hands as artists.
For nearly a decade, I have been teaching the art of natural wreath making: a slower, more traditional approach rooted in working with the materials rather than forcing them into place. This is not about creating a perfectly arranged wreath. It is about learning to see like an artist, noticing the shape of a branch, the curve of a leaf, the texture of a piece of foliage, and allowing nature to guide the process.
The studio will be filled with the colours, textures, and fellings of autumn, adorned with freshly fallen foliage and natural treasures gathered from the landscape around us. Together, we will weave these pieces into something beautiful, creating wreaths that feel organic, personal, and connected to the season they were made in.
There is something deeply meaningful about gathering from the natural world and creating with what is around us. This tradition of collecting, weaving, and transforming nature’s offerings is something humans have done for generations. It connects us to the rhythms of the season and to a quieter, more instinctive way of making.
You are welcome to bring along special pieces you have gathered and love: a favourite leaf from a walk, foliage from your own property, or little treasures that hold a memory of autumn.
We will also experience the beautiful process of preserving leaves with beeswax. The warmth, the scent, and the transformation of these delicate pieces of nature create a moment that feels almost magical.
This workshop is an opportunity to create something beautiful together, learn a meaningful craft, and experience the magic of working with nature in a way that honours its beauty and individuality.
You will leave with a handmade wreath, but more importantly, with the memory of a shared experience and a deeper connection to your daughter and the season around you.
